Nearly 160 migrants voluntarily deported from Libya to Nigeria
A group of 159 illegal migrants has been voluntarily repatriated from Libya to Nigeria, according to the International Organization for Migration (IOM). The migrants returned safely from Benghazi to Lagos under the IOM’s Voluntary Humanitarian Return and Reintegration (VHR) programme, which is supported by EU funding.
